In the new film “Challengers,” Zendaya, Mike Faist, and Josh O’Connor take on the roles of tennis players entangled in a web of love and competition. Directed by Luca Guadagnino, known for his work on “Call Me By Your Name,” this stylish and synth-y drama is sure to captivate audiences with its unique take on the sports genre.
The story follows the lives of three characters – Tashi, Art, and Patrick – as they navigate the complexities of friendship, love, and ambition on the tennis court. As the tension builds during a qualifying match at the New Rochelle Tennis Club, flashbacks reveal the fractured relationships and egos at play.
O’Connor shines in his role as Patrick, shedding his previous image as Prince Charles in “The Crown” to portray a cocky and slightly broken bad boyfriend. Faist’s Art and Zendaya’s Tashi add layers to the story, creating a dynamic trio that keeps viewers on the edge of their seats.
Written by playwright Justin Kuritzkes, “Challengers” is a prickly treat that delves into themes of infidelity, ambition, and the blurred lines between friendship and competition. With a runtime of 131 minutes, the film is rated R for language, sexual content, and nudity.
